What skills and experience we're looking for
The successful candidate would be expected to teach classes across the primary range, so should have strong literacy and numeracy skills and experience of working with children in an education setting.
We are looking for someone who can:
·utilise advanced skills and curriculum knowledge to prepare high quality teaching sessions. ·complement our teachers’ delivery of the national curriculum and contribute to the development of a subject area including policies and strategies. ·successfully plan, teach and assess whole classes. ·be flexible and adaptable when working with a range of colleagues and pupils. ·has a commitment to ensuring that every pupil achieves the best that they possibly can, ·has high expectations in all areas of school life.

Commitment to safeguarding
The school and Trust is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children and young people and expects all staff and volunteers to share this commitment. The successful application will be required to undertake an Enhanced Disclosure via the Disclosure & Barring Service.
